Индикатор-LRC_DTS-коробка
Индикатор «LRC — Linear Regression Curve» (Кривая линейной регрессии) разработан на языке QLUA для терминала QUIK (КВИК).

Индикатор LRC строит на графике линию линейной регрессии по выбранной цене за заданный период. В отличие от обычной скользящей средней, LRC не просто усредняет цену, а рассчитывает наиболее подходящую прямую по методу наименьших квадратов и выводит ее текущее значение на последней свече расчетного окна.

LRC-QUIK-Linear-Regression-Curve

Главная идея индикатора заключается в том, чтобы определить текущее направление цены не по простому среднему значению, а по линии, которая статистически лучше всего описывает движение цены за указанный период.

Если цена в последние бары преимущественно растет, линия LRC будет направлена вверх. Если цена снижается, линия будет наклоняться вниз. При боковом движении линия обычно становится более горизонтальной.

Индикатор может использоваться для:

  • определения направления текущего тренда;
  • сглаженного отображения ценового движения;
  • поиска моментов изменения наклона линии;
  • фильтрации сделок по направлению рынка;
  • сравнения текущей цены с расчетной линией регрессии.

Формула расчета индикатора LRC

Индикатор LRC рассчитывается по методу линейной регрессии.

1. Для выбранного периода берется ряд цен:
Price[1], Price[2], …, Price[N]

где:
N — период расчета;
Price — выбранная цена свечи: Open, High, Low или Close;
X — порядковый номер бара внутри расчетного окна;
Y — цена соответствующего бара.

2. Строится линейная функция:
Y = a + b * X

где:
b — наклон линии регрессии;
a — свободный коэффициент;
Y — расчетное значение линии LRC.

3. В индикаторе LRC_DTS на график выводится значение линейной регрессии для последнего бара расчетного периода:
LRC = a + b * (N — 1)

Таким образом, индикатор показывает расчетную точку линии регрессии на текущей свече.


Применение индикатора LRC в торговле

1. Определение направления тренда

  • Если линия LRC направлена вверх, это говорит о преобладании восходящего движения за выбранный период.
  • Если линия LRC направлена вниз, это указывает на нисходящую тенденцию.
  • Если линия движется почти горизонтально, рынок может находиться в боковом движении или фазе неопределенности.

Направление-тренда-по-LRC

2. Фильтрация торговых сигналов
Индикатор LRC можно использовать как фильтр направления сделок.

Например:

  • рассматривать покупки, когда цена находится выше линии LRC и сама линия направлена вверх;
  • рассматривать продажи, когда цена находится ниже линии LRC и линия направлена вниз;
  • избегать сделок, когда линия LRC плоская и рынок находится во флете.

Такой подход помогает не торговать против основного движения рынка.

3. Пересечение цены и линии LRC
Одним из простых вариантов использования является наблюдение за пересечением цены и линии индикатора.

Возможные сигналы:

  • цена пересекает LRC снизу вверх — возможный сигнал к росту;
  • цена пересекает LRC сверху вниз — возможный сигнал к снижению.

Важно учитывать, что пересечения лучше использовать вместе с дополнительными фильтрами: объемами, уровнями поддержки и сопротивления, старшим таймфреймом или другими индикаторами.

4. Изменение наклона линии
Изменение наклона LRC может указывать на изменение рыночной динамики.

Например:

  • линия была направлена вниз, затем начала выравниваться и разворачиваться вверх — возможно ослабление продавцов;
  • линия была направлена вверх, затем стала плоской или начала снижаться — возможно ослабление покупателей.

Такой сигнал особенно полезен при анализе окончания импульса или перехода рынка в консолидацию.

4. Уровни поддержки и сопротивления
Поддержка-по-LRC
Кривая линейной регрессии также может служить динамической поддержкой и сопротивлением, поскольку она способна адаптироваться к изменяющемуся ценовому действию.

— Когда цена находится выше линии LRC, она может выступать в качестве уровня поддержки, предполагая, что цена может отскочить от линии и пойти выше.
— И наоборот, когда цена находится ниже линии LRC, она может выступать в качестве уровня сопротивления, указывая на то, что цена может столкнуться с понижающим давлением и развернуться вниз.


Настройки индикатора «LRC_DTS»

Индикатор-LRC_DTS-Настройки
В индикаторе доступны следующие настройки:
1.Period период расчета линейной регрессии.
Чем меньше период, тем быстрее линия LRC реагирует на изменение цены, но тем больше может быть ложных колебаний.
Чем больше период, тем более сглаженной становится линия, но реакция на изменение тренда будет медленнее.

2.Цена для построения — по каким ценам свечей будет рассчитываться индикатор.
Можно указать варианты:
  — O — Open (открытия свечи);
  — H — High (максимум свечи);
  — L — Low (минимум свечи);
  — C — Close (закрытие свечи).
Чаще всего для расчета применяется цена закрытия, так как она отражает итоговое значение свечи.

3. Внешний вид линии
Также можно настроить параметры отображения линии индикатора:
— цвет;
— толщину;
— тип линии.

Установка индикатора «LRC» на график терминале QUIK

Для установки индикатора необходимо добавить Lua-файл индикатора в папку LuaIndicators пользовательских индикаторов QUIK, после чего выбрать его на графике через меню добавления индикаторов.

После установки индикатор можно добавить на график нужного инструмента и настроить период расчета, цену построения и внешний вид линии.
LRC-Добавление-на-график
 
LRC-Добавление-на-график2

Практические рекомендации
Индикатор LRC_DTS можно использовать как самостоятельный инструмент анализа направления цены, но наиболее эффективно он работает в составе торговой системы.

Используйте наши Стратегии и знания!
Это поможет Вам в максимально короткие сроки освоить такое интересное направление Трейдинг, а также начать эффективно торговать на финансовых рынках.

Мы постарались сделать максимально низкие цены за наши наработки, уверены, что эти затраты окупятся в многократном размере!!!

Информацию по цене индикатора «LRC — Linear Regression Curve» можно посмотреть тут!

Индикатор-LRC-коробка
 
 
 


Вы уже сейчас можете начать изучать Видео курс- роботы в TSLab и научиться самому делать любых роботов!
 
Можно записаться на следующий поток ОнЛайн курса «Создание роботов в TSLab без программирования», информацию по которому можно посмотреть тут->
 
Также можете научиться программировать роботов на нашем Видео курсе «Роботы для QUIK на языке Lua»
 
Если же вам не хочется тратить время на обучение, то вы просто можете выбрать уже готовые роботы из тех, что представлены у нас ДЛЯ TSLab, ДЛЯ QUIK, ДЛЯ MT5, ДЛЯ КРИПТОВАЛЮТЫ!
 
Также можете посмотреть совершенно бесплатные наработки для МТ4, Квика, МТ5. Данный раздел также постоянно пополняется.
 
Не откладывайте свой шанс заработать на бирже уже сегодня!